| /** |
| * Parses and compiles a formula to a highly optimized function. |
| * Combination of {@link parse} and {@link compile}. |
| * |
| * If the formula doesn't match any elements, |
| * it returns [`boolbase`](https://github.com/fb55/boolbase)'s `falseFunc`. |
| * Otherwise, a function accepting an _index_ is returned, which returns |
| * whether or not the passed _index_ matches the formula. |
| * |
| * Note: The nth-rule starts counting at `1`, the returned function at `0`. |
| * |
| * @param formula The formula to compile. |
| * @example |
| * const check = nthCheck("2n+3"); |
| * |
| * check(0); // `false` |
| * check(1); // `false` |
| * check(2); // `true` |
| * check(3); // `false` |
| * check(4); // `true` |
| * check(5); // `false` |
| * check(6); // `true` |
| */ |
| export default function nthCheck(formula: string): (index: number) => boolean; |
